Fee increase coming for ZCB-Design

Since launching in 2017, CAGBC has been able to maintain pricing for Zero Carbon Building – Design certification. To ensure the Standard can continue to evolve at the pace of the market, and that customers can receive the best support, CAGBC will be increasing fees by 10 percent effective January 1, 2023. Pricing for ZCB-Performance is not impacted.

Owners and developers have found ZCB-
Design to be a great framework and facilitator for achieving their decarbonization goals for new construction and retrofits. With over 175 projects registered under the standard, the market is learning how to design future-proof buildings that provide maximum long-term benefits to owners and tenants alike.
